What does “cameraman” mean?

The word “cameraman” means a person who operates a film or television camera as their job. In plain terms, the person behind the camera on a film or TV crew.

How do you pronounce “cameraman”?

“Cameraman” is pronounced KAM-ruh-man (/ˈkæm(ə)ɹəˌmæn/ in IPA).

How do you use “cameraman” in a sentence?

Here is “cameraman” used in a sentence: “The cameraman followed the players down the tunnel.”

What part of speech is “cameraman”?

“Cameraman” is a noun.
